An explosion proof lamp supplier provides certified lighting solutions designed to prevent ignition in hazardous environments while ensuring long-term reliability under harsh industrial conditions.
That’s the formal definition. But in actual procurement and installation, the real question is different:
Can this supplier deliver consistent performance beyond certification?
From years working alongside industrial buyers and contractors, one pattern repeats—most issues don’t come from missing certificates. They come from inconsistent manufacturing, weak thermal design, and lack of real-world validation.

Real Application: Supplier Selection in Oil & Gas Project
Choosing an explosion proof lamp supplier is rarely based on price alone.
What Actually Happens During Projects
Delivery timelines affect installation schedules
Minor product inconsistencies delay commissioning
Technical support becomes critical under pressure
In one refinery project, switching suppliers mid-phase added weeks to the timeline—not due to certification issues, but due to inconsistent fixture performance.

Common Problems with Explosion Proof Lamp Suppliers
These issues don’t always appear immediately.
1. Inconsistent Product Quality
Same model, different performance:
uneven brightness
thermal variation
2. Weak Thermal Engineering
Leads to:
premature driver failure
reduced lifespan
3. Limited Technical Support
During installation:
slow responses
unclear documentation
